摘要
The performance of high-resolution, fully depleted silicon detectors at low photon energies has been found to be dominated by incomplete charge collection due to the pn junction entrance window. Two alternative experimental methods to characterize this behaviour have been investigated by using monochromatized synchrotron radiation at the radiometry laboratory of the Physikalisch-Technische Bundesanstalt with the electron storage ring BESSY: the measurement of the de photocurrent relative to a calibrated diode and the measurement of the energy-dispersive response function in the single photon counting mode. Both methods are discussed and compared with a theoretical model including a microscopic description of the photoelectric absorption and a charge-collection probability function.
